Who Is Shonda Rhimes?

Shonda Rhimes is an American writer, producer, author, and the founder and CEO of Shondaland. She became a major television force after creating Grey’s Anatomy, which premiered in 2005 and quickly became the breakthrough that reshaped her career. From there, she expanded into a larger creative universe with Private Practice, Scandal, and Shondaland-produced series including How to Get Away with Murder.

Her rise was not built on a single hit. Rhimes became one of the few creators in television whose name could anchor an entire programming identity. At ABC, her influence grew so large that Shondaland dramas helped define the network’s Thursday-night lineup for years. That success established her not only as a high-profile showrunner, but also as a producer with unusual leverage in the business.

In 2017, Rhimes made one of the most closely watched moves in Hollywood when she left network television for an exclusive partnership with Netflix. That shift opened a new chapter for Shondaland, leading to streaming-era projects such as Bridgerton, Inventing Anna, Queen Charlotte: A Bridgerton Story, and The Residence. By that point, Rhimes was no longer just a prolific TV writer. She was running a global media company with reach across streaming, editorial, audio, brand partnerships, and more.

Shonda Rhimes Estimated Net Worth

Shonda Rhimes’ estimated net worth in 2026 is widely placed at around $240 million. That figure should be treated as an estimate, not a confirmed personal financial disclosure. Public net worth numbers for entertainment figures are usually assembled from reported deals, salaries, producing credits, and business activity rather than audited filings.

Even with that caution, the general picture is clear. Rhimes ranks among the most financially successful creators in television because her career combines several powerful revenue drivers at once: a deep catalog of hit series, long-term executive producer income, the business value of Shondaland, and a major Netflix relationship that expanded her earning power far beyond the broadcast era.

Her wealth also reflects durability. Many entertainment careers peak around one breakout project, then flatten. Rhimes did the opposite. She built momentum in network television, carried that power into streaming, and turned her creative track record into a broader business platform. That kind of career structure tends to produce much stronger long-term wealth than one-off project paydays.

Shonda Rhimes Net Worth Breakdown

Grey’s Anatomy and the ABC Years Built the Foundation

The foundation of Shonda Rhimes’ fortune was laid during her ABC years, especially through Grey’s Anatomy. The series became a defining television hit, and its long life gave Rhimes something far more valuable than a single successful launch: a durable franchise. A show with that kind of staying power can create income through writing and producing fees, renewals, licensing, syndication, and the continuing value of its library.

She followed that success with Private Practice and then Scandal, strengthening her reputation as one of the most commercially reliable creators in television. Shondaland also became associated with more hit programming, including How to Get Away with Murder. According to Forbes, Rhimes’ ABC hits such as Grey’s Anatomy and Scandal brought in more than $2 billion for Disney, ABC’s parent company. That number does not represent her personal income, but it does show the scale of value she created, and scale like that tends to lead to larger contracts and stronger backend opportunities.

Shondaland Added Real Business Value

A big reason Rhimes’ net worth stands out is that Shondaland grew into more than a production label. It became a recognizable media company with its own identity, audience trust, and commercial reach. That shift matters because wealth in entertainment is often built not just by making shows, but by owning a brand that can keep producing value across different formats and platforms.

Shondaland now describes itself as a global media company working across film, streaming, audio, digital, editorial, brand partnerships, merchandise, and experiences. In practical terms, that means Rhimes’ financial story is tied to a larger enterprise, not only to her original screenwriting work. The company’s breadth gives her more than project fees. It gives her strategic leverage, broader monetization channels, and a stronger long-term business position.

The Netflix Deal Changed Her Earning Power

The next major leap came with Netflix. Rhimes first signed with the platform in 2017, a move that marked one of the clearest symbols of television’s shift from traditional network power to streaming power. For Rhimes, it also meant moving from being one of broadcast TV’s dominant creators to becoming a central figure in Netflix’s premium-content strategy.

That relationship expanded in 2021. Netflix said the broader pact would cover not only series, but also feature films, and potentially gaming and virtual reality content. It also widened the Shondaland business relationship to include live events and experiences. Reported figures around the deal have varied, and Netflix did not publicly disclose a contract value, but industry coverage has consistently treated the arrangement as one of the most lucrative creator deals in Hollywood.

That matters for any realistic estimate of Rhimes’ wealth. Even without a precise public number, a long-term exclusive deal of that scale can significantly increase both annual earnings and overall net worth, especially when it builds on an already proven catalog and an established company.

Bridgerton Became a Major Streaming Franchise

Bridgerton gave Rhimes more than a successful Netflix debut. It proved that her influence could expand in a new era and with a new audience. The series became one of Netflix’s signature franchises, and its success opened the door to further growth through Queen Charlotte: A Bridgerton Story and continued expansion of the larger Bridgerton universe.

That kind of franchise success has obvious financial importance. A hit that grows into a broader world can strengthen a producer’s value well beyond one season of television. It deepens brand power, extends audience loyalty, and reinforces the platform’s incentive to keep investing in the creator behind it. For Rhimes, Bridgerton helped confirm that her commercial peak did not end with ABC.

The same is true of the wider Netflix slate. Rhimes and Shondaland have stayed active with projects such as Inventing Anna and The Residence, which keeps her company visible in the streaming conversation instead of relying only on legacy hits.

Library Value, Producer Income, and Long-Term Leverage Keep the Fortune Growing

One of the most important but least flashy parts of Rhimes’ wealth is the long-term value of her catalog. A creator tied to successful shows that keep streaming, licensing, and attracting new viewers is in a stronger financial position than someone who depends entirely on fresh projects for every new payday. Grey’s Anatomy alone remains a major pillar in that picture.

Her role also matters. Rhimes is not simply a credited writer on famous shows. She has operated as a creator, executive producer, company founder, and CEO. Those positions can come with multiple layers of compensation and more influence over the business life of a project. While the exact financial terms remain private, the structure of her career strongly supports a high net worth estimate.

There are also smaller supporting streams around the edges, including books, speaking opportunities, and the broader visibility that comes with being one of television’s best-known creative executives. Still, those are supporting layers, not the core. The real engine of Shonda Rhimes’ fortune is the business of hit television and the company she built around it.

That is the clearest way to understand her estimated wealth in 2026. Shonda Rhimes did not build her fortune through short bursts of fame. She built it by creating enduring intellectual property, turning Shondaland into a true media company, and staying commercially relevant across both broadcast television and the streaming era.
